Scholarly note

Catalogue entry from CDLI (Ur III (ca. 2100-2000 BC)) — HLC 219 (pl. 108). No scholarly translation has been published; the transliteration is from the ATF (CDLI's Atf-Friendly format). [year-name] Dated to Amar-Suen y6 — Šašru destroyed based on canonical year-name formula in the transliteration.
